Performance Overview: AT&T Defies Market Trends
AT&T's performance defies the prevailing market sentiment, where many equities are languishing. The company's stock has surged from a previous close of $22.72 to the current $23.515, driven by robust earnings that exceeded analysts' expectations.
Historical Context and Current Surge
Historically, AT&T has been a reliable income stock, but its growth has often been overshadowed by its debt levels and competition. However, recent strategic moves, including divesting its stake in DirecTV, have refocused the company's efforts on its primary telecom operations. This strategic pivot, along with the addition of 800,000 mobile and fiber customers, has revitalized investor confidence.
